The Yokogawa NP53*A, also cataloged as the NP53*A Basic MFCU Processor Card, operates as a dedicated hardware component for deterministic control loop execution within Yokogawa CS 3000 Field Control Stations.
| Parameter | Specification |
|---|---|
| Model | NP53*A |
| Brand | Yokogawa |
| Origin | USA |
| Weight | 0.80 kg |
| Dimensions | 17.8 x 5.1 x 33.0 cm |
| Operating Temp | -10 to +60 deg C |
| Power Consumption | <= 10 W |
| Processor Architecture | 32-bit RISC |
| Processing Speed | >= 50 MIPS |
| Memory Capacity | 1 MB ROM, 128 KB RAM |
| Operating Voltage | 24 VDC +/-10% |
| Communication Interfaces | RS-232C, RS-485, CAN, Modbus, DeviceNet |
| Form Factor | Chassis plug-in card |
The NP53*A processor manages real-time continuous loop calculations while executing channel-to-channel isolation protocols across attached field I/O backplanes. During high-density data exchanges, the card handles 4-20 mA HART loop protocol passes without introducing signal attenuation or measurement jitter. Internal firmware routines apply cold junction compensation (CJC) algorithms to ensure linear voltage conversion for direct sensor inputs. Additionally, integrated signal filtering prevents high-frequency electromagnetic noise from disrupting primary processing memory addresses.
Q: Does replacing an NP53*A processor card require a manual firmware re-flash during field commissioning?
A: Engineers can insert the card as a direct drop-in replacement without performing a field firmware flash, provided the system backplane configuration matches existing hardware revisions.
Q: How does the processor maintain signal integrity during power voltage fluctuations?
A: The onboard power regulation circuitry accepts 24 VDC within a +/-10% tolerance band, actively filtering input ripple to protect internal memory blocks from voltage transients.
Q: Can maintenance personnel extract the NP53*A card while the station chassis remains powered?
A: Operators must isolate power or execute standard station shutdown protocols before card removal to prevent bus communication disruption and static discharge risks.
